  • History & Memorable Moments

Granada High School is a high school located in Livermore, California. Established in 1963, it is part of the Livermore Valley Joint Unified School District (LVJUSD). Granada was established as the town's second public high school in response to significant population growth in the 1960s. Livermore High School was the first high school in Livermore, and rivals Granada. The name Granada is a Spanish word with a dual meaning of pomegranate and grenade. The school's official newspaper was "El Toro" and now is called "The Pomegranate." The school mascot is a matador. [1]
